Transaction c6aad806ebecee181090f960eeca3e63ecb609be2c4c4b48ff0cad18ea564525

block
24b00ac5ab37a64dfc49ff2cdcf9086ce7245008859cf100d84309c15414e4d2

1 Input

543 Outputs